Purification (Comment) | Organism |
---|---|
native enzyme 75.5fold to homogeneity from apples purification in presence of AEBSF and aprotinin by ammonium sulfate fractionation, dialysis, gel filtration, and hydrophobic interaction chromatography, followed by anion exchange and hydroxyapatite chromatography | Malus domestica |

additional information | substrate specificity of the purified enzyme, overview, highest PPO activity occurs with 4-methylcatechol, followed by catechol, pyrogallol, (-)-epicatechin, caffeic acid, and DL-dopa, little or no activity is detected toward the monophenolic compounds ferulic acid, L-tyrosine, and phenol | Malus domestica | ? | - |
